Preserve Your Views And Your Privacy

Homes on the Orlando coast have some of the best views of any home in Florida, and while you’d love to keep them clear 24 hours a day, you also need to think about your privacy. Thin blinds or draperies may be all the rage in some homes, but they’ll also let anyone walking outside see inside your home.

Rather, choose a window treatment with more versatility like plantation shutters, which let you have a good amount of flexibility on both your privacy as well as your views. The adjustable louvers allow for an entire spectrum of visibility, and the shutters themselves can swing open or closed, so you can change at different times of the day or just based on your needs.

 

Don’t Let Salty Air Damage Your Windows

Owning a home on the Florida coast means you’re no stranger to saltwater and the ocean air. Salty air can lead to rust on your car, corrosion on metal patio furniture, and damage on your window treatments and windows.

White shutters in Orlando coastal home
 
For form and function to last you years, you need a window treatment that doesn’t hold moisture. The best waterproof window treatments will be faux wood blinds or Polywood plantation shutters. Both can shrug off moisture, keeping your window treatment and frame free from mildew, corrosion, and smells.
 

Keep Your Space and Your Options Open

The ocean doesn’t always have to be bad news, though. One of the best experiences of being a Orlando homeowner is opening up the windows to let in that fresh sea breeze. To make it even better, you should have a window treatment that won’t swing or flap wildly in the breeze. Stay away from light drapes or curtains that only hang from a top rod, and depending on how breezy your neighborhood gets, blinds may even be a bad idea. Instead, look for a window treatment that’s more secure, such as shutters.
